With the cry "Increase the Deficit" the Jackson county chamber of com merce swung Into action today on & now flv-yr program to dredge Bear creek to the sea. so that battle veawla of the United StaM fleet can proceed up as far aa Medford to participate In Armlxtlce Day pro grama here in the future. The new program, one of the most comprehensive to be undertaken In the history of the chamber, li ex pected to start a boom In thla city, and launch one of the greatest ex pansions In the history of the Pa cific coast. "For many years," said A. H. Ban well, manager of the chamber, "It ha been a public disgrace that this elty has had no battleships upon which to sprinkle flowers from the Bear creek briage." Many letters from citl7ns, prominent and otherwise, gave rtae to the great project, when the public gave Indication that It would no longer tolerate the shame- , fui situation. "Mwlford has been In I the back seat long enough," said j W. S. Bolger. former president of j the chamber, thumping the table- Another project of tremendous lm- porta nee to this community to be launched will be the construction of a tram-way, starting at the rim of Crater Ike, clearing the coast range, and swooping down upon the coast at a point near Gold Beach, where a huge amuaement park la to be built at public expense. The park, which will be the largest of lta kind tn the world, has been tentatively named New Medford, and contracts for the work will be let In the near future, Is was learned today. New stream-lined cars will be built by the Boeing airplane factory, which has Indicated a desire to aurt a factory here. The cars, which will run on the Crater-lake-to-the- aea tram, will be capable of attain- lri even , greater speeds than those attained by high school students on South Oakdsle, if plans of the com I pany for new models, now In the ; wind-tunnel stage of development, i are completed. j In order to clear the air for the huge caravans of Incoming settlers, work la to begin In the next day or two on blasting off 800 feet from the top of Roxy Ann, which has been condemned aa a hazard to airplanes. "What a day for Medford I" cho rused Banwell and Bolger to the re porter as the latter fled from the scene dlazlly. but carefully avoiding a plump and Inviting looking purne lying on the akidway that serves for a front step to the chamber of fices. Moody, assistant attorney general, and Mrs. Moody, former Ash land newspaperwoman arrived to day to spend a few days In the city and valley. Attorney General Moody will also attend to state legal mat ters while here. The assistant attorney-general at tended to msny of the legal details of the last legislative session. Moody was prosecutor In the L. A. Banks murder trial and the Jackson county ballot theft cases. Communications Tnwnwnd Man Pressure.
